What Are Composite Doors?
Composite doors are engineered doors made from a mix of products. These typically include:
- P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ride): Provides a strong base and adds to the door's insulating residential or commercial properties.
- Composite products: Usually consist of wood, glass-reinforced plastic (GRP), and other materials, providing a durable structure that imitates the look of wood without the maintenance issues.
- Insulation core: Typically made from foam or other insulating materials that enhance the energy effectiveness of the door.
Why Choose Composite Doors?
Composite doors stand apart amongst standard wood or metal doors for several compelling factors. Here are a number of essential advantages:
- Durability:Composite doors are developed to stand up to severe weather, including heavy rain, snow, and strong winds. Unlike wooden doors, they do not warp, swell, or crack with time.
- Security:These doors are generally built with multi-point locking systems, making them far more challenging to get into compared to standard doors. The robust materials utilized in their building include an additional layer of security.
- Energy Efficiency:With their insulated core, composite doors master keeping heat within your home. This energy performance can lead to lower heating bills, making them an economically sound choice in the long run.
- Low Maintenance:Unlike traditional wooden doors that need routine painting or staining, composite doors are easy to clean and generally need very little maintenance. Just wipe down the surface area with a moist cloth to keep them looking brand-new.
- Aesthetic Appeal:Composite doors can be found in a selection of styles, colors, and finishes. They can be made to duplicate the appearance of standard lumber doors while staying structurally remarkable, using flexibility in style to fit any home.
- Environmental Friendliness:Many manufacturers use recycled products in the construction of composite doors. This makes them a more sustainable alternative compared to standard wooden doors, which contribute to logging.
Factors to Consider When Choosing Composite Doors
Before purchasing composite doors, it's necessary to think about several aspects that influence their efficiency, appearance, and expense:
- Quality and Certification:Look for doors that have been accredited by acknowledged organizations for quality and safety standards. This ensures that you're acquiring a product that meets market benchmarks for resilience and security.
- Design and Design:Consider the architectural design of your home before choosing a design. Composite doors come in numerous styles, including modern, traditional, and even bespoke alternatives customized to your requirements.
- Energy Ratings:Like home appliances, doors also include energy ratings. Examine for the energy efficiency rating label to guarantee you are making a wise investment that contributes to decrease energy costs.
- Setup:Proper setup is essential to the performance of your composite door. It is extremely suggested to use professional installers to guarantee that the door fits completely and operates smoothly.
- Service warranty:Most composite door producers provide service warranties, guaranteeing that your financial investment is secured. Make certain to check out the small print and understand what is covered under the warranty.
- Cost:Composite doors typically vary from mid to high rate points. While they might be more costly than conventional wood doors, the long-term savings in maintenance and energy effectiveness can offset this initial expense.
